How much do scale master j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for scale master in Florida is $43.36,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$37.02 and $49.42 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Scale Master?

A Scale Master is responsible for weighing trucks, materials, or products using industrial scales to ensure accurate weight measurements. They typically work in industries such as logistics, waste management, agriculture, or construction. Duties include operating scale equipment, recording weight data, verifying load compliance, and coordinating with drivers and site personnel. Attention to detail and knowledge of weight regulations are essential for this role.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a Scale Master?

A Scale Master is responsible for accurately weighing inbound and outbound vehicles, recording data, and ensuring all documentation is complete and correct. On a daily basis, you’ll interact with truck drivers, coordinate with dispatch or shipping teams, and address any discrepancies in records or weights. You may also be involved in inspecting equipment for accuracy, troubleshooting technical issues, and enforcing site safety procedures. This position often serves as a key point of contact between the loading dock, logistics teams, and external drivers, ensuring smooth operations throughout the day.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Scale Master position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Scale Master, you need strong attention to detail, mathematical aptitude, and experience with industrial weighing operations,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with digital truck scales, data entry systems, and sometimes certification in hazardous materials handling or scale operation software is important. Excellent communication, customer service, and time management skills help build positive interactions with drivers and team members. These competencies are essential for accurately recording weights, ensuring compliance, and maintaining smooth logistics operations.

Job description

As the Structures Sub-AMP Manager, you will perform carpentry work such as fabricating items according to designs, blueprints, drawings and sketches. You will also be responsible for carpentry repair or reconstruction work on items such as damaged wood stairs, floors, frames, rafters, joists, and trusses to ensure conformity with building codes. Repair doors, roofs, ceilings, stairs, floors, windows, and roll-up doors.

This role will also manage the performance of a wide variety of carpentry related tasks, including new construction, remodeling, renovation, and demolition.

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:

  • Reads blueprints, sketches, and modification orders to plan the process and layout to be performed in an expeditious, economical, and effective manner.
  • Carpentry constructs, repairs, restores and installs structures such as floors, doors, windows, stairways, furniture, cabinets, and shelves.
  • Builds forms, frames, ceilings and roofs with common materials to include lumber, plywood, wafer board, sheetrock, steel studs, foam board, and cement board.
  • Fabricates items according to designs, blueprints, drawings, and sketches.
  • Repairs or reconstructs damaged wood stairs, floors, frames, rafters, joists, and trusses to ensure conformity with building codes.
  • Repair doors, roofs, ceilings, stairs, floors, windows, and roll-up doors.
  • Cleans equipment, shop area, and work site area.
  • Responsible for observing all current OSHA, AFOSHA ES&H and fire regulations
  • Perform other duties as assigned by Alternate Site Management or Supervisor lead.

E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E:

  • High School Diploma or GED.
  • Must have at least Eight (8) years of carpentry experience.
  • Must be a Journeyman or Master Certified Carpenter

ADDITIONAL REQUIREMENTS:

  • Must possess a valid U.S. Driver's License
  • Possess a valid U.S. Passport (preferred)
  • Able to obtain and maintain a valid Residency Visa for Jordan
  • Must be able to work in extreme environmental conditions including dust and high temperatures.
  • Must be able to endure long hours, exposure to weather and hazardous conditions.

TRAVEL:100%, in deployed location.

SECURITY CLEARANCE:Must have and maintain a DoD Secret Clearance.
